Ogie Alcasid Celebrates His Birthday With A Concert for World Vision

On his 50th natal day, Singer/composer Ogie Alcasid is celebrating it with a concert for a cause. Nakakalokal is also the name of his album and he will be joined by Inigo Pascual, Solenn Heusaff, Jaya, Kayla, Angeline Quinto, Yeng Constantino, his own daughter; Leila and many more.


Ogie Alcasid is also a brand ambassador for World Vision which will serve as a recipient for the proceeds of the concert. World Vision continues to look for sponsors for children who needed schooling, developed communities, and now campaigning against Child Sexual Exploitation.

The highlight of the concert is the duet of Ogie Alcasid and Richard Supat, formerly of the FORTEnors. Richard himself is a World Vision scholar and also worked with for the non-profit organization. It will be fitting because he is a testimony on how his life was change by World Vision.


Ogie Alcasid’s concert will be at Kia Theater on August 25, 2017 at 7:30 PM. Tickets ranges from P500 to P3,000. Nakakalokal concert is brought to you by World Vision, A-Team and in cooperation with PLDT Home. If you want to take part of World Vision’s campaign if you are interested to sponsor a child’s education, you may inquire at the booth during the concert.

Ogie Alcasid scores Gold for The Songwriter and The Hitmakers

Ogie Alcasid’s latest release The Songwriter and The Hitmakers does not only celebrate his 25th anniversary in showbiz, but also the achievements of OPM in recent years. The album was recently presented a Gold Record Award for outstanding sales of the album.

Universal Records General Manager Kathleen Dy-Go presented the award to Ogie during the GMA Variety Show Party Pilipinas last January 13.

The Songwriter and The Hitmakers was just released last October.
The album gathers all the biggest singing and recording artists in the country to breathe life to Ogie’s compositions, including both his biggest hits and new songs. Gary Valenciano, Regine Velasquez, Martin Nievera, Piolo Pascual, Christian Bautista, Sarah Geronimo, Arnel Pineda, Noel Cabangon, Richard Poon, Jed Madela, Kuh Ledesma, Rachelle Ann Go, Kyla, JayR and Jaya are part of the album.
